Kelly Kennedy-Ryu, CPA, is a Director in the Professional Practices Group at Marks Paneth & Shron LLP. She provides accounting and auditing services to clients in the financial services, real estate and construction industries as well as the not-for-profit sector. In addition to traditional audit services, her experience includes solving technical issues for closely held businesses that require an extensive range of expertise including start-up entities, acquisitions, discontinued operations and bankruptcy.
Ms. Kennedy-Ryu concentrates on technical reviews of financial statements in a multitude of industries and related revenue recognition issues. She also plays a significant role in continuing professional education for the firm through the development of seminars and courses. Ms. Kennedy-Ryu also monitors the firm’s compliance with quality control standards and supervises the peer review process.
Prior to joining Marks Paneth & Shron, Ms. Kennedy-Ryu worked in the internal accounting, quality control and professional education arenas at two other large professional services firms. Ms. Kennedy-Ryu is active in creating an environment that focuses on technical excellence in the accounting field. She chairs the Nonprofit Interest Committee of the New Jersey Society of CPAs (NJSCPA) and previously served as the chair of its Compilations and Reviews Group. Her 20-year commitment has led to her being frequently asked to speak on new accounting and compliance matters by CPAs and controllers.
Ms. Kennedy-Ryu belongs to Soroptimist, which is an international organization for business and professional women who work to improve the lives of women and girls in local communities and throughout the world. She serves on the membership committee of her local chapter. In addition, she is a volunteer for the New Jersey School of Ballet.
Ms. Kennedy-Ryu holds a Bachelor of Science in Accounting from Manhattan College and has continued her education with management courses at Rutgers University. She is based in Marks Paneth & Shron’s Manhattan headquarters.
